And during system startup call to mountd displays the following lines > > clnttcp_create: RCP: Program not registered > clnttcp_create: RCP: Program not registered > clnttcp_create: RCP: Program not registered > clnttcp_create: RCP: Program not registered > > Could anybody explain what could be the cause and what was not done > properly ? What should be done to hide/dismiss them ? Did you install pcnfsd? OS/2's NFS uses this and it won't work right without it. rpc_pcnfsd is in ports.
